    Clean the small hole in the back of the refrigerator freezer and place it as follows:

    Tools needed: thin hose, hot water, large-capacity syringes, dish soap, etc.

    1. As shown in the figure below, connect the syringe to the hose, and insert the other end into the drainage hole to pump out the stagnant water and dirt inside.

    2. After the hot water is filled, mix some dish soap, use a syringe to absorb the hot water, and then pump it into the drainage hole, stop when the water overflows the drainage hole, and then suck the water out, heat the water into it, and repeat it several times until the drainage pipe is dredged.

    3. As shown in the figure below, use the hose to insert the drain hole until the hose comes out of the other end of the drain hole.

    4. Fold the bottom cover at the back of the refrigerator, and you can see that the hose is exposed to the drainage hole and is on top of the tray. The hole is cleared.

    Reason for blockage:

    1. It is because when you are refrigerating food, some residues of food enter the small hole of the refrigerator water outlet, so that if you accumulate too much, it will block the refrigerator water outlet, so that the refrigerator drainage will not be smooth, 2. If the ice in the refrigerator water outlet is not melted in time, the refrigerator water outlet will also be blocked.

    Workaround:

    1. If the reason why the refrigerator outlet is blocked is because of ice accumulation, you should first disconnect the power supply, then empty the items in the refrigerator, and open the door of the refrigerator, so that the ice in the refrigerator outlet will melt, and the refrigerator outlet will not be blocked.

    2. If there is a foreign object into the drainage hole, you can open the small lid behind the refrigerator, you can see the drainage pipe head, blow the pipe (or blow with a gas pump) to blow out the debris, and then pour some water from the drainage hole in the refrigerator (add a small amount of washing) to rinse several times.

    The refrigerator drain hole is very important, if it is blocked, it will cause water accumulation in the refrigerator.

    It should be checked from time to time, so as not to have too many blockages, and after getting under the hole, it will be very troublesome to dredge; In addition, in order to reduce the situation that there is too much condensation in the refrigerator and the moisture is too high, which causes mold and clogs the water outlet hole, those items that usually have residual water should be drained and poured before putting them in.

    1. Unplug the power socket of the refrigerator first, and then remove the baffle behind the refrigerator after leaving it for a period of time. Prepare a small wire, stretch it into the drainage hole, and pound it up and down to dredge it. 2. In addition, it can also be cleaned, you need to prepare a syringe, there must be a small water pipe, put it on the syringe, and absorb the water into the small hole.

    Repeat it many times to clean the small holes in the refrigerator and unclog it. 1.
